The Swedish fashion house have FINALLY landed in Australia with an exclusive collection to make up for their late arrival
If you’ve never shopped outside Australia, you might not have heard of H&M. They’re a Swedish fashion brand who sell a range of collections that vary in price and quality. You can find basic tube skirts, maxi dresses and essential vests (singlets) for a few bucks, next to woollen coats, leather bags and real suede boots for a few more dollars. It’s no wonder they’re so popular, plus they do awesome sales with most pieces 50% off, and their jeans have a great reputation.
Most importantly, they’re stylish, they follow trends and collaborate with designers regularly to create collections that fly off the rails – well, actually, they’re snatched off in a stampede of girls that spend hours queueing outside the stores before the first sale day – true story.
ANYWAY, for years they have shipped to America, all over Europe, and popped up in Asia, with store locations including Kuwait, Oman and Qatar. But not Australia. Can someone explain this, please?
Never mind, because finally they’ve created www.hm.com/au ahead of their first Aussie store opening in Melbourne on 5th April. But before we all join hands and dance, unfortunately you can’t buy the items online, they’re just there to tease you over to Melbourne for the launch.
